Letizia Borghesi will race her trusty Cannondale LAB71 SuperSix EVO for the 20th edition of the Tour of Flanders on Sunday.
For a race day as intense as Flanders, the LAB71 SuperSix EVO is ideal. Built from ultra-light carbon, its low drag profile helps take some of the bite out of relentless, punchy climbs.
Letizia rides with a high cadence, preferring to spin her legs, so her Ultegra 11-34 cassette will let her legs turn over a little easier as she races up the steep bergs. She has opted for the FSA SL-K carbon handlebar as its rounded profile makes it easier to grip and offers added comfort when she's flying on the cobbles.
With a trio of climbs in the last 25 kilometers, winds in the forecast, and of course five cobbled sectors, Letizia is looking forward to taking on the 20th edition of the Tour of Flanders. It will certainly be one to remember.
Specifications: Letizia Borghesi's LAB71 SuperSix EVO
Frameset:
Cannondale LAB71 SuperSix EVO (51)
Seatpost:
5mm set back
Groupset:
Dura-Ace DI2
Handlebar:
FSA SL-K carbon bar
Handlebar tape:
Prologo
Saddle:
Prologo Scratch M5
Pedals:
Wahoo Speedplay
Chainrings:
FSA chainrings 52/36
Cranks:
FSA KFL
Cassette:
Ultegra cassette 11-34
Powermeter:
4iiii powermeter
Wheels:
Vision Metron 40 tubular
Tires:
Vittoria Corsa 28c tubular
Computer:
Wahoo ELEMNT ROAM
